When I attempt to delete 1Password 7 on my Mac, I keep getting a message that it can't be deleted because it's open. It is not open . . . what's the problem?

    Try quitting 1Password completely with Control-Option-Command-Q. Then drag it to the trash from the Applications folder, empty the trash, and restart your computer.if you ever might want to retrieve your data, do not use an app cleaner to remove it.

    It does not work for me. I get a message that says The item “1Password 7.app” can’t be moved to the Trash because some of its extensions are in use.

    @photog - please close all of your browsers (Safari, Chrome, Firefox). The open Activity Monitor (inside the Utilities folder which is in your main Applications folder) and see if there are any 1Password processes running. If there are, quit them. Then try deleting 1Password again. Don't use any app cleaners or uninstallers to do this, as these programs can remove more data than we want them to. Just drag the 1Password app to the Trash.
